Permits have been filed for a new housing complex at 1860 Pleasant Valley Avenue in Oakland, Alameda County. The project aims to add several units to a vacant lot located one block away from Piedmont Avenue. Emeryville-based Bitzer Banker Development is listed as the project applicant.

The three-story structure is expected to produce seven units. Apartment types will vary with three townhome-style units, three studios, and a one-bedroom unit. Parking will be included for three cars, with bicycle parking not specified.
The project architect is not specified. Illustrations show development will produce two distinct structures, with the apartments overlooking the sidewalk, and three attached townhome-style units in the rear lot. The exterior will be wrapped with green horizontal siding and white board panels.

Public records show the property last sold in July 2024 for $315,000. The property owner is listed as a Colorado-based LLC. The estimated cost and timeline for construction have yet to be shared.
